Induction

Induction refers to the process by which air and fuel are mixed and delivered to the engine cylinders for combustion. In most modern vehicles, the induction system is made up of several components that work together to ensure optimal engine performance and fuel efficiency.

The induction system typically includes an air intake system, which brings outside air into the engine. The air intake system often includes a filter to remove impurities from the air before it enters the engine. This is important because clean air is essential for the proper functioning of the engine.

The fuel system is also a critical component of the induction system. The fuel system is responsible for delivering the correct amount of fuel to the engine cylinders for combustion. In most vehicles, the fuel system includes a fuel pump, fuel filter, fuel injectors, and fuel pressure regulator.

The fuel pump is responsible for delivering fuel from the gas tank to the engine. The fuel filter helps to remove impurities from the fuel before it reaches the engine. The fuel injectors are responsible for spraying the fuel into the engine cylinders at the correct time and in the correct amount. The fuel pressure regulator helps to maintain a consistent fuel pressure in the fuel system.

In addition to the air intake and fuel systems, the induction system also includes several sensors and control modules that monitor engine parameters and adjust the air/fuel mixture accordingly. This helps to ensure optimal performance and fuel efficiency, while also minimizing emissions.
